Ingersoll-Rand Reaffirms

Aug 01, 2008 (EarningsWhispers Guidance Summaries via Comtex) -- IR |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ating -- Ingersoll-Rand (NYSE: IR |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) said it expects third quarter earnings of $1.05 to $1.10 per share on revenue of $4.40 billion to $4.50 billion. The current consensus earnings estimate is $1.06 per share on revenue of $4.44 billion for the quarter ending September 30, 2008. The company also said it continues to expect 2008 earnings of $3.80 to $3.90 per share. The current consensus earnings estimate is $3.69 per share for the year ending December 31, 2008.
